Woodstar finish new EP with help of Stephen Street
Woodstar have completed the recording of their new EP with Cranberries and Smiths man Stephen Street producing.
A big fan of the Limerick band, Street flew over to Dublin to record the four-tracker in Windmill Lane Studios.

With Regal/Parlophone not renewing their option on the band, the follow-up to Time To Bleed will surface through the Wet Clay label in September.
